    Icsist, notice that my UI is minimal in terms of what buttons show. If I am in Bear, only those buttons show. If I am in Cat, only those show. If I am in Caster, my healing buttons appear and my current Cat/Bear buttons becomme my Caster DPS buttons.

    I also recently added Healing buttons to the left near my CTRA for quick click-heals of the raid.

    Below my buffs, I have Mark and Thorns that show if I don't have them and they have a macro that targets me and casts...so I lose the buff, the button shows, I click it, I get buffed, the button dissapears...

    Flexbar is going to be getting a nurf when the expansion comes out...so don't try learning it just yet. They are redeveloping it (I'm an admin on their forums.)...it's just not going to have some of the combat functions that it used to.

    yeah ive experimented abit with Flexbar, it seemed alright, but I felt that it was unnecessary for me. I use to have the healing buttons like that as well.. but now i have an add on for my keyboard that is basically a nother set of keys labelled 1 - 10. Thats what i use for casting my healing touch spells.. so i kind of went away from the whole " click target, click spell, click target, click spell thing".. It was difficult getting use to at first, but now i dont think i could cast healing spells with my mouse anymore..

    Thats why you probably found it odd that I only have 2 healing touch spells on my cast bars as a resto druid :P
